吳 峰,許 磊
(中國石油天然氣股份有限公司獨山子石化分公司 鐵路運輸公司,克拉瑪依 833699)
如何保障運輸生產安全是企業專用鐵路面臨的一個重要問題。企業專用鐵路現有的安全管理普遍存在體系不健全,措施缺乏執行力,安全檢查工作缺乏持續性和針對性,及缺乏有效技術手段支持等問題[1]。安全管理系統在城軌領域應用較為普遍,如城軌交通施工安全監控管理信息系統和運營隧道監測預警系統等[2-5],這些系統均采用地理信息系統(GIS,Geographic Information System)技術與工作流(Workflow)技術相結合的方式對異常監測、風險預警、安全評估和安全培訓進行管理,取得了良好的應用效果[6]。此外,在道路交通、礦業冶金、工程建設、石油化工等領域也有相關的安全管理系統,這些系統大多側重于視頻監控和Workflow 構建,不具備動態信息監控和即時管理的能力。
GIS 是以地理坐標為基礎,收集、管理、操作、分析及顯示空間數據的信息系統[7]。本文研發的企業專用鐵路生產安全管理系統以GIS 和Workflow 為基礎,從實際需求出發,以車列高精度定位為技術內核,以移動App 為即時安全管理工具,將生產監控與安全管理深度融合,與聯鎖、無線調車機車信號(STP)、列車運行控制記錄(LKJ)、調度集中(CTC)、機車視頻監控等系統打通接口,實現信息共享,發揮動態監控和即時管理作用。
系統網絡依托于4G 移動網絡和系統專用局域網,其網絡拓撲如圖1 所示。

圖1 網絡架構
(1)中心機房子網:設有差分機站接口機、接口服務機、應用服務器、數據庫服務器和Web 服務器。差分接口機用于接收來自實時動態(RTK,Real - Time Kinematic)差分基站的校正數據;接口服務機提供與其他計算機和生產系統的接口服務;應用服務器與Web 服務器分別提供后臺邏輯運算和Web 訪問。
(2)辦公局域網:實時監控終端和設備維護終端通過辦公局域網接入系統,用于監控設備狀態和管理維護數據。應用客戶端用于可視化監控和實現Workflow。
(3)外部網絡:連接外部網絡的設備可通過瀏覽器、移動App 的方式訪問系統。
系統需要實現桌面客戶端、瀏覽器和移動App3種方式的訪問,出于統一性和可維護考慮,系統采用J2EE 平臺的SSM(Spring MVC+Spring+MyBatis)框架進行開發,其技術架構如圖2 所示。

圖2 軟件結構和技術框架
(1)數據管理層:采用SQL Server 數據庫管理軟件。
(2)數據持久層:采用MyBatis 框架,該框架支持定制化SQL、存儲過程及高級映射,可使用簡單的XML 或注解配置SQL 語句,實現程序對象與數據庫的ORM 映射,將系統軟件與數據庫管理軟件解耦,降低軟件的復雜度,提高軟件的可擴展性與可移植性。
(3)業務邏輯層:采用Spring 框架,該框架是一個輕量級控制反轉(IoC)和面向切面(AOP)的容器框架,能夠提供一個統一、高效地構造整個應用的方式。
(4)Web 服務層:采用Spring MVC 框架。該架構是Spring 面向Web 項目開發的延伸產品,具備高可配置性,是典型的MVC 架構解決方案。
(5)表示邏輯層:由于GIS 窗口需要顯示大量動、靜元素,通過網頁訪問較為困難,所以采用符合OGC Web 服務規范的開源軟件GeoServer 加以實現。GeoServer 基于J2EE 開發標準,應用Servlet 和Struts 框架,與Spring 框架兼容性高,同時兼容網絡地圖服務(WMS)和網絡要素服務(WFS)特性,支持廣泛的GIS 數據格式。利用GeoServer 可以方便地發布地圖數據并實現交互,允許用戶對特征數據進行增刪改查操作,還可以迅速在用戶之間共享空間地理信息。
(6)用戶層:分為桌面客戶端、瀏覽器和Andriod 移動App3 種訪問方式,分別采用WinForm、JSP 和Android Studio 技術進行開發,3 種方式使用同一數據服務,但有不同的布局和權限,其中,基于WinForm 的桌面客戶端具備完整的顯示和操作功能。
系統分為動態監控、設備安全管理、安全事件管理、人員管理、安全教育、權限管理6 個基本功能模塊,如圖3 所示。動態監控模塊是系統的核心。

圖3 系統功能架構
(1)GIS 動態監控:顯示企業專用鐵路全線平面圖。其中,靜態元素包括:鐵軌、供電設施、信號設備、土擋、盡頭線、標志性建筑等;動態元素包括:機車、車輛,及調車計劃、施工活動、裝卸作業、巡道活動等事務信息和預警信息。
(2)實時車站聯鎖:展示機車運行軌跡、現車分布、調車計劃、貨物裝卸信息,功能界面如圖4 所示。

圖4 實時車站聯鎖界面
(3)設備生產安全提示:展示機車、車輛、道口、道岔、信號機、軌道區段、車號識別等設備的工作狀態和檢修信息;展示道口報警、線路天窗、機車超速、冒進、線路施工、用戶發現并上傳的安全事件文本描述或圖片。
(4)安全活動監控:用于實時監控巡道、巡檢人員的活動軌跡。
(1)設備分布圖:包括電務圖、施工圖、線路圖、隱蔽設施分布圖、設備圖、綜合圖等。其中信號機、道岔實物在GIS 地圖中具備真實坐標。
(2)維護檢修資料:錄入日常檢查檢修工作記錄,通過工作日志自動生成周、月匯總,形成單項設備檢修歷史記錄。
(3)檢修期管理:按照檢修記錄及已錄入的檢修周期,形成檢修周期管理,系統自動提示和記錄。
(4)設備信息維護:可以對設備基礎信息進行修改。
該模塊用于處置安全事件。用戶在移動App 上用文字描述、位置定位和拍照的方式發起安全事件并上傳至服務器。
安全管理員接收移動App 上報的安全事件,按工作流程進行跟蹤和處理,處理過程包括風險識別、整改和復查3 個主要環節,具體流程如圖5 所示。

圖5 安全事件處理流程
流程中,整改計劃的內容包括整改人、復查人以及整改期限,對逾期未完成的要說明原因。流程結束后,系統將對事件發起人進行安全積分結算,作為激勵制度的依據。
該模塊依托于手機、平板、手環等智能移動終端,包含巡檢任務上報、安全事件上報和安全積分體系3 個功能模塊。
(1)巡檢任務上報:巡檢是專用鐵路安全工作的一項重要內容,包括工務巡道、車務危化品巡檢和電務檢查。巡檢工作執行不到位可能造成安全隱患。系統通過手機App 定位巡檢人員的行動軌跡、巡檢節點掃碼等技術措施,確保巡檢工作切實落地。
(2)安全事件上報:工作人員在任一時間、地點發現安全隱患均可形成安全事件,上報系統。
(3)安全積分體系:安全積分是員工對企業安全產生貢獻的量化指標,基于安全事件上報的情況,根據發起安全事件的價值和相關規則確定分值。
安全教育功能包括安全資料庫、安全培訓、安全考試3 個功能模塊。
(1)安全資料庫:數據來源主要包括法律法規、企業規章、設備操作規程、事故案例、培訓資料等。
(2)安全培訓:從資料庫中選擇培訓內容供培訓對象學習。
(3)安全考試:錄入安全考試題目,考察培訓對象學習的成果。在實際應用中,用于承包商、外雇員工的安全專題培訓和考核。
該模塊用于系統用戶的身份驗證,可進行崗位權限設置、用戶管理和單位管理,并具備指紋識別功能。
(1)繪制GIS 地圖。利用定位儀對地形進行測繪,得到鐵路沿線的經緯點集合,再參考公開的衛星圖片描繪站場主要的建筑和地理特征。具體方法為:建立RTK 基站,使用手持或車載定位儀沿每條鐵軌的中線運動,收集RTK 定位數據,導入Map-GIS、MapInfo 等地圖工具中進行連線、繪圖、標注,如圖6 所示。

圖6 經測繪和標注后站場主要建筑和地理特征示意
(2)建立測繪線路與聯鎖區段的映射關系。將GIS 線條按軌道區段(以絕緣節為界)劃分成GIS 線段,再用軟件拆分成間隔1 m 的標準經緯點集合,其數據結構示例如表1 所示。

表1 GIS 線段與聯鎖區段映射
表1 示例為一段名為GS1 的GIS 線段及其對應的聯鎖區段1DG。線段的實際長度為56 m,被拆分成56 個點,點與點之間相隔1 m。表中記錄了每個點與線段起點、終點的距離,以便判斷該點在區段中所處位置和比例。
(3)映射關系建立后,將車載定位單元上傳的定位點與GS1 標準點集進行比對,選取相距最近的標準點作為實際定位點的替代值,轉換為屏幕坐標,填充機車圖標形成動態運動顯示。
衛星定位受到環境、天氣和地形條件影響,不可避免會存在定位漂移的問題,即使是高精度RTK定位在信號遮擋區或線路密集區也容產生較大誤差。機車定位的準確度關系到行車安全,需采取多種定位手段對衛星定位進行校正。可用方案有聯鎖進路信息校正和地面信標校正。本系統采用在聯鎖覆蓋區域運用進路信息校正技術,在非聯鎖區域的重要地點(道岔、盡頭線、停車點等)加設地面信標的方式實現定位校正。
僅對機車頭進行定位并不能滿足安全管理需要,對車尾和車列所在位置的推算也十分重要,通常情況下,使用沒有嚴格寫實的調車計劃獲取車輛換長數據進行計算有可能產生較大誤差。本文采用從調車計劃獲取車輛換長數據計算車長[8],結合速度積分車長算法驗證的方案。具體實現過程為:(1)從鐵路運輸管理信息系統(TMIS)的調車計劃中獲取計劃車數及各車輛的換長數據,計算出計劃車長;(2)根據速度積分算法得出驗算車長,將兩者進行比對,若相差不超過3 m,則可判定車長數據正確。
速度積分計算如圖7 所示,其原理為:記錄車列進入和出清某一聯鎖軌道區段的時間t0和t1,同時,采集進入和出清的瞬時速度v0和v1。期間車載終端不斷從車載LKJ 或GYK 系統采集機車當前速度,用速度對時間的積分算出總距離,加上車軸到車箱前端的距離,減去軌道區段A 的長度,即可得出驗算車長。
企業專用鐵路生產安全管理系統自2019年4月在獨山子石化公司上線以來,已經采集各類安全事件378 次,有效安全事件86 件,其中,設備設施安全隱患34 件,人員不安全行為41 件,其他事件11 件。有效安全事件全部整改到位,并對發起人進行了相應的激勵。另外,系統對站場線路、道岔、信號設備、機車等要素均已做到精確定位和展示,發揮了對運輸生產的監督、監控作用。
本文結合安全管理理論和企業專用鐵路實際需求,設計了適用于企業專用鐵路的生產安全管理系統,闡述了系統的網絡架構、技術架構、系統功能和關鍵技術,增強了對企業專用鐵路生產安全的管控。目前,除發揮生產監控和安全管理作用外,系統的GIS 信息和車列定位數據等信息資源僅用于展示和監控,利用不夠充分,下一步將利用此類信息資源,以高可靠性車列定位和無線通信網絡為基礎,向安全控制領域拓展延伸,開發行車速度、距離防護、上道作業防護等行車安全控制功能。

圖7 聯鎖速度積分算法